According to the Population Reference Bureau, a reputable non-profit organization, the world's population in 8000 B.C.E. was a mere 5 million. Fast forward to 1 C.E., and we see a significant jump to 300 million. From there, it gradually increased to 500 million by 1650. However, the real population explosion occurred post-medieval times, with the world reaching 1 billion in 1800 and a staggering 8 billion in 2022.
So, how many people have ever lived on Earth? An estimated 117 billion individuals have called our planet home, and here's the kicker: a whopping 7% of that total are alive right now! That's a statistic that truly puts things into perspective.
